The renewal of our three-year agreement with Torvane Materials has been assessed in detail. Proposed terms include a 4.2% unit-price increase, partially offset by improved volume rebates and extended payment terms of sixty days. Sensitivity analysis indicates a net annual cost impact of under 1% on the Meridia product line, assuming stable demand. Legal has flagged no material changes to liability clauses. We recommend approval, subject to the conditions outlined in the confidential note below.

confidential, yawip-bahif: Zorokox Partners plans to lower the Casax list price by 28.0 percent in April. The board signed off on a budget of $271.0 million for Project Juldor. The renewal with Pelokox Partners closes at $410.1 million a year, 3.4 percent below the last contract. Project Pelok slips by a full year because of the audit delay.

// Gating rules for Pelicanroll canary deploys. Heads up for security
// review: the abort thresholds below are intentionally paranoid — we'd
// rather roll back a healthy canary than let a bad one soak. Error-rate
// windows are short on purpose; widening them needs sign-off from the
// Driftgate owners. The gating constants are defined as follows.

tuning table, kahop-fahog:
RATE_LIMITS = {
    "wenix": 1,
    "druael": 10,
    "holix": 1,
    "zorael": 1,
}

## Graphweft: layout budget (excerpt)

For this week's sync: the dependency graph visualizer now caps layout work per frame rather than per graph, which keeps the UI responsive on the larger monorepo graphs we've been testing. Edge bundling kicks in past a node threshold, and label rendering degrades in two stages as zoom decreases. These thresholds were picked from profiling runs on the Thornequay test corpus and are intentionally conservative. The current tuning constants are shown below.

constants for kahag-yagag:
BUDGETS = {
    "tamax": 449,
    "holiel": 156,
    "isteth": 181,
    "silath": 575,
    "zorys": 821,
    "briax": 1007,
    "quenox": 276,
}